For Students

Supporting You on Your College or Career Journey

The Passport to Careers program is a publicly-funded scholarship and support program that helps Washington students—specifically those who have been in various types of foster care or who have experienced unaccompanied homelessness—prepare for careers.  Help includes money to put toward the costs of earning a college certificate or degree or job training through a pre-apprenticeship or apprenticeship program. Help also includes experts to help answer your questions and navigate your pathway.

If you are eligible, you have the choice of two postsecondary pathways: Passport to College leads to a college degree or certificate, and Passport to Apprenticeship leads to an apprenticeship or pre-apprenticeship program.

Emergency Funding

Washington Passport Network also offers emergency funding to Passport students. Students can apply to receive short-term and/or one-time financial assistance for unexpected/unavoidable financial emergencies that directly impact or jeopardize continued enrollment in college.
